I've been investigating this, after recently modifying some image-download code -- I was wondering if that could be related. It doesn't seem to be, but I'll report some findings from along the way:
Before 0a76199, the DataURIExtractor could successfully match data URIs during latex builds: the above condition would always fail, allowing fallback to the final check for the data: protocol scheme (v7.3.0 permalink).
